How correlated are APAM and FNGD?

Over the past 3 years, APAM and FNGD moved with a correlation of -0.37, which is negative, meaning they tend to move in opposite directions. Lately the two have moved closer together, with the 1-year correlation at -0.26 versus -0.37 over 3 years. Over 5 years the correlation is -0.48, and the annualized covariance of weekly returns is -756.4 %².

Among the 17 assets we track against APAM, FNGD sits near the bottom by co-movement, at rank #15. Their recent paths diverged sharply: over the last 12 months APAM outperformed by 56.9 percentage points (+1.2% for APAM against -55.7% for FNGD). Note the risk asymmetry: FNGD runs 2.8 times the annualized volatility of the other leg, so equal-weighting the two is not an equal-risk position.

How is this computed?

Pearson correlation on weekly returns: ρ(A,B) = cov(rA, rB) / (σA · σB), over windows of 52, 156 and 260 weeks. Covariance is annualized (×52) and expressed in %². Full definitions on the methodology page.

What does a correlation of -0.37 mean?

On the −1 to +1 scale, -0.37 describes how much the two returns move together: +1 is lockstep, 0 is independence, negative values mean opposite directions. It says nothing about which performed better.
